Aerial work platforms (AWPs) have become essential equipment across sectors ranging from construction and facility maintenance to power utilities and warehousing. These machines offer safe, elevated access to work sites that would otherwise require ladders, scaffolding, or makeshift equipment, reducing risk and improving operational efficiency. Businesses rely on AWPs to complete installation, inspection, cleaning, painting, and repair tasks at height. Increased safety regulations across industries are prompting organizations to integrate aerial lifts to ensure compliance and reduce workplace injuries.
Different types of AWPs—such as boom lifts, scissor lifts, vertical mast lifts, and truck-mounted platforms—are used depending on mobility requirements, platform height, and load capacity. Compact designs and electric-powered lifts are particularly growing in demand due to their suitability in indoor facilities as well as environmentally conscious construction sites. Manufacturers are exploring lightweight materials and hybrid power systems that enhance mobility while reducing emissions.
